Quick Description: A 53-story, 1987 Mayan mirage towering over the western edge of downtown, Heritage Plaza’s Mayan-inspired theme, developed by M. Nasr & Partners, carries into the lobby.

Long Description:Heritage Plaza, along with
"http://www.waymarking.com/waymarks/WMZQR">Bank of America
Center, dominates the western skyline of the city. The building is
topped with a granite, Mayan-inspired crown. The Mayan theme
continues into the lobby. Rather than demolish the historic
"http://www.waymarking.com/waymarks/WM1PDA">Farm Credit Banks
Building, M. Nasr wrapped Heritage Plaza around it.
Heritage Plaza was the corporate headquarters for Texaco until
Texaco’s merger with Chevron. The newly-formed Chevron-Texaco
eventually moved all of their operations to the former
"http://www.waymarking.com/waymarks/WM1ZHW">Enron Buildings,
vacating Heritage Plaza. The interior of the skyscraper is
currently being remodeled, but, being the only major downtown
building not connected to Houston's underground tunnel system, its
future remains uncertain.
